安多霖对受电磁辐射照射小鼠免疫功能和生殖能力的影响 被引量:12

Effects of anduolin on some immune and reproductive functions in electromagnetic irradiated mice

摘要 目的探讨安多霖对受高功率电磁脉冲照射小鼠免疫功能和生殖功能的影响。方法100只小鼠随机分为5组,3个给药组,2个对照组,即:阴性对照组和模型对照组。给药组动物连续灌胃给药8d,经6×104V/m高功率电磁脉冲全身一次照射2min,照射后继续给药至第10天。小鼠脱臼处死取脾脏和附睾,测定自然杀伤(NK)细胞和淋巴细胞转化活力;检测精子数、精子畸形率和精子活动度。结果给药小鼠NK细胞和淋巴细胞转化活力3个给药组的均值分别为(167.000±0.031)%和(0.600±0.017)A;模型组分别为(0.110±0.019)%和(0.39±0.02)A,给药组与模型组之间的差异显著。给药组小鼠精子计数与模型组之间的差异无显著性,但小鼠睾丸精子活动度显著增强,精子畸形率则明显降低。结论安多霖对高功率电磁脉冲照射小鼠免疫功能和生殖能力有明显的增强作用。 Objective To study the effcts of anduolin on some immune and reproductive functions in high power electromagnetic radiaded mice. Methods Mice were divided into 5 groups, including 3 drug and 2 control groups. Mice were orally administrated with anduolin for 8 consecutive days and then irradiated by 6 × 10^4 V/m high power electromagnetism for 2 minutes once, After irradiation,the mice were continuously given anduolin to the 10th day. Then spleen and epididymis were taken to detect activation of natural killer cells, lymphocyte proliferation and counts, movement degree and rate for abnormality of germ cell. Results Activation of natural killer cells and lymphocyte proliferation in drug groups were significantly higher,while the rate of abnormality of germ cells were significantly lower than those of the controls. The movement degree of germ cells was increased significantly and the counts of germ cells was unchanged compared with the irradiated model control group. Conclusion Anduolin has certain effects on immune and reproductive functions in high power electromagnetic irradiated mice.
